marina users.” Craig Western, director at Wincer Kievenaar, adds, “The original brief simply put, was to raise the bar of UK yachting facilities to a standard that would not be out of place in a spa hotel. In addition, for facilities of this nature it was important to ensure the fixtures and materials were robust and fit for purpose.” The building has been designed to be both contemporary and practical, with individual wet and dry areas, under floor heating, LED lighting


and the very latest in sanitary ware. Vaulted ceilings were constructed to allow maximum light and ventilation to the modern tiled facilities below. Every detail has been considered; from heated mirrors to prevent them ‘steaming up’ to heated seats in the shower cubicles and an ultra-efficient heat recovery extraction system, which removes steam but doesn’t reduce the room temperature. Craig adds, “Wincer Kievenaar has had a close working relationship with the yacht harbour for many years. The practice has worked with Jonathan to continually develop and improve facilities available at the harbour and to bring a degree of architectural cohesion to the entire site.”
